Antique sugar bowl of good size, made of porcelain, with floral decoration. Stamped underneath corresponding to the Léon Sazerat factory (1831/1891), trained at Sèvres. Awarded a gold medal at the 1878 Paris World Exposition. It was decorated by the President of the Republic, Sadi Carnot, in 1888. It can also serve as a biscuit jar. In very good condition! Dimensions: 20 cm wide including the handles X 16 cm high. Weight: 602 grams.
